I get an Error: There are no active mixer devices available.?



Answers:
Ensure the Windows Audio service is started.

Reinstall sound driver.

Repair SNDVOL32.EXE
1.Click the Start button, then click Run.
2.In the Run window, next to Open, type MSCONFIG.
3.Click the OK button.
4.In the System Configuration Utility window, on the General tab, click the Expand File button.
5.In the Expand One File from Installation Source window, in the File to restore box, type SNDVOL32.EX_.
6.In the Restore from box, type C:\Windows\I386.
7.In the Save file in box, type C:\Windows\System32.
8.Click the Expand button.
9.In the System Configuration Utility window, click the OK button.
In the System Configuration window, click the Restart button

Perform a system restore to when the device was working properly
Install sound driver.
